Less Balance Sheet Health
Financial Health criteria checks 0/6
Less has a total shareholder equity of PLN-1.1M and total debt of PLN756.0K, which brings its debt-to-equity ratio to -66.4%. Its total assets and total liabilities are PLN615.0K and PLN1.8M respectively.

Financial Position Analysis
Short Term Liabilities: LES has negative shareholder equity, which is a more serious situation than short term assets not covering short term liabilities.
Long Term Liabilities: LES has negative shareholder equity, which is a more serious situation than short term assets not covering long term liabilities.
Debt to Equity History and Analysis
Debt Level: LES has negative shareholder equity, which is a more serious situation than a high debt level.
Reducing Debt: LES's has negative shareholder equity, so we do not need to check if its debt has reduced over time.

Cash Runway Analysis
For companies that have on average been loss-making in the past, we assess whether they have at least 1 year of cash runway.
Stable Cash Runway: LES has less than a year of cash runway based on its current free cash flow.
Forecast Cash Runway: LES has less than a year of cash runway if free cash flow continues to reduce at historical rates of 30% each year
